Semenyih Hi-Tech 3 in Hulu Langat, Selangor recorded 2 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M4.80 million and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M151.

This area consists exclusively of commercial properties, with no residential list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M4.80 million,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M2.09 million to RM7.50 million, and a typical market range of RM3.44 million to RM6.15 million.

Most transactions involved detached factory/warehouse, with moderate diversity in property types available.

For price per square foot, the median is RM151, with most transactions between RM138 and RM163. The usual range is RM144.38 to RM156.88,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M12.50 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M13 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
